  Book Review:   OK, romance fans. This time I’m reviewing a modern classic, “Love Story” by Eric Segal. Recognize the catch phrase… “Love means never having to say you’re sorry”? That’s from (you guessed it) this heart-wrenching slice of life tearjerker. Written in a straight-forward pithy style with a sharp yet tender voice, this book will only take you a few hours to read… but what a read! Romance and realistic fiction are my two least favorite genres (for personal reasons that I won’t go into right now). That said, I was deeply moved by Segal’s story. The emotional truth of the writing was clear and convincing. The ending was tragic but transformational. College love and lose narrated in a believable way that won’t make your average cynic want to throw up.
